spoonsThe Prowler was made for crusin, so what's your Favorite Driving Route in the Prowler?

Mine so far have been:

1. Finger lakes in Western New York. Start out in Penn Yan to see some Amish people then head east to Rt 14 which runs along Seneca lake. Head south on Rt 14 toward to Watkin Glen on the way stop at a few wineries along the way. In Watkins Glen cruise down main street over the Old Grand Prix Finish Line and stop for a small hike in Watkins Glen park. Then take Rt 414 north up the east side of the lake to Rt. 79. Stop a long the way at a few wineries. Then head east on Rt. 79 to the end of lake Cayuga lake where the city of Itaca is located. Along your travels you'll pass more than 50 wineries, 100's on B&B, farm stands and beautiful scenary. Prowler's are rarely ever scene in these parts so you'll get the royal treatment and it's really CHEAP to stay & play in the finger lakes region!!


2. US1 from Key Largo down to Key West. In the Prowler it's a great ride over those long bridges.

3. In Central Vermont take Rt 4 west of I-87 thru the towns of Quechee, Woodstock, Bridgewater up to Killington during the late summer. Stop at the Quechee Gorge and lunch at the Long Trail Brewery on Rt. 4. Head soutn from Killington on Rt. 100 back east on Rt. 9 to Brattleboro, VT where you can pick up I-91. Great scenary of the small towns, country and coverbridges along the way.
